Skip to content
Commits on Jan 2, 2012
  1. Skip registration of null values.

    Michael Aufreiter committed Jan 2, 2012
Commits on Dec 23, 2011
  1. Allow metadata for Data.Objects.

    Michael Aufreiter committed Dec 23, 2011
  2. Updated build script.

    Michael Aufreiter committed Dec 23, 2011
Commits on Oct 13, 2011
  1. Merge pull request #36 from timjb/master

    Schema Visualization
    Michael Aufreiter committed Oct 13, 2011
  2. @timjb

    Add script that converts schema.json files to dot language for visual…

    …ization with graphviz
    timjb committed Oct 13, 2011
Commits on Oct 3, 2011
  1. Fixed test suite.

    Michael Aufreiter committed Oct 3, 2011
Commits on Sep 15, 2011
  1. Explicit null values during rebuild phase (see previous commit) did n…

    …ot work with object type properties. So here's another fix.
    Michael Aufreiter committed Sep 15, 2011
  2. Consider null values when an object is (re)built with new data.

    Michael Aufreiter committed Sep 15, 2011
Commits on Sep 9, 2011
  1. Consider deleted documents in validation functions.

    Michael Aufreiter committed Sep 9, 2011
Commits on Aug 29, 2011
  1. Allow null values being passed explicitly for unique object type prop…

    …erties.
    Michael Aufreiter committed Aug 29, 2011
  2. Fixed test suite.

    Michael Aufreiter committed Aug 29, 2011
Commits on Aug 28, 2011
  1. Consider all error types.

    Michael Aufreiter committed Aug 28, 2011
  2. Validator functions are now properly JSON-encoded.

    Michael Aufreiter committed Aug 28, 2011
  3. Enable different sync modes (push, pull, full)

    Michael Aufreiter committed Aug 28, 2011
  4. Ensure unloaded objects are are not marked _dirty.

    Michael Aufreiter committed Aug 28, 2011
Commits on Aug 12, 2011
  1. Fixed typo in Data.Graph#toJSON.

    Michael Aufreiter committed Aug 13, 2011
  2. Removed compromised character. Fixes #27.

    Michael Aufreiter committed Aug 13, 2011
Commits on Aug 2, 2011
  1. Merge branch 'master' of github.com:michael/data

    Michael Aufreiter committed Aug 2, 2011
  2. Updated example app to Backbone 0.5.2. Now using pushState instead of…

    … hashChange for routing.
    Michael Aufreiter committed Aug 2, 2011
Commits on Aug 1, 2011
  1. Merge pull request #24 from timjb/master

    Fixed two bugs that I noticed when I was reading the source
    Michael Aufreiter committed Aug 1, 2011
  2. The Tasks app now features synchronization in both directions. Also c…

    …onflicts are detected and resolved by the app.
    Michael Aufreiter committed Aug 1, 2011
  3. Updated Underscore.js

    Michael Aufreiter committed Aug 1, 2011
  4. Updated seed script.

    Michael Aufreiter committed Aug 1, 2011
  5. Synchronize tasks relationship.

    Michael Aufreiter committed Aug 1, 2011
  6. @timjb
  7. Exposing /graph/pull service.

    Michael Aufreiter committed Aug 1, 2011
  8. Implemented bi-directional (pull, push) synchronization.

    Michael Aufreiter committed Aug 1, 2011
  9. Given a list of node ids and revisions CouchAdapter#pull checks for r…

    …emote updates. Changed nodes are delivered to the client.
    Michael Aufreiter committed Aug 1, 2011
  10. An interface to graph/pull for the AJAX Adapter.

    Michael Aufreiter committed Aug 1, 2011
  11. @timjb
Commits on Jul 28, 2011
  1. Options are optional.

    Michael Aufreiter committed Jul 28, 2011
  2. Merge pull request #23 from gr2m/master

    Minor fixies to example app.
    Michael Aufreiter committed Jul 28, 2011
Commits on Jul 27, 2011
  1. @gr2m

    fixed config.json.example

    gr2m committed Jul 27, 2011
  2. @gr2m

    we need async module

    gr2m committed Jul 27, 2011
  3. @gr2m

    adding config.json.example

    gr2m committed Jul 27, 2011
Something went wrong with that request. Please try again.